China's Influencer Marketing Laws



China's regulative structure for influencer marketing makes up a complex network of laws, guidelines, and guidelines that influencers, firms, and brand names should adhere to to avoid potential dangers.


Staying notified about regulatory updates and comprehending compliance challenges are vital for successful influencer marketing in China.


Secret regulations governing influencer marketing in China consist of:



  1. Cybersecurity Law: Regulates online material and data storage, impacting influencer marketing projects that involve data collection and online promos.




  1. Marketing Law: Develops guidelines for marketing content, including constraints on false or misleading claims, and requirements for clear labeling of advertisements.




  1. E-commerce Law: Regulates online commerce, including influencer marketing projects that involve item sales or promotions.



Increased enforcement of these guidelines by Chinese authorities has actually caused fines and charges for non-compliant influencers, firms, and brands.


To decrease compliance risks, working together with skilled influencer companies and legal professionals familiar with China's regulatory landscape is necessary.


Adapting to regulatory updates allows brands, influencers, and companies to carry out compliant and effective influencer marketing projects in China.

What Commission Rates Do Influencer Agencies in China Normally Charge?



Influencer agency commission rates in China exhibit substantial irregularity, usually subject to negotiation based on project scope, influencer tier, customer budget, and agency proficiency.


Basic cost structures span 10% to 30% of overall campaign expense, with some firms choosing for flat charges or inflating influencer rates to guarantee profitability.


Efficient commission negotiation necessitates in-depth market knowledge and market acumen to secure fair, transparent agreements that cultivate trust in between companies and clients.


Understanding the subtleties of charge structures is pivotal for customers seeking to optimize returns on influencer marketing financial investments in China's complex and vibrant market landscape.
